Orange Unified becomes the sixth California school system to require notification of parents when their child identifies as transgender.
Republicans lacking power in California are focusing on local school boards’ policies, setting up a fight with Gov. Gavin Newsom over ‘parental rights.’The resolution includes some changes from when it was first introduced. The revised policy states that parental notification does not have to be made if a child is 12 or older and if the child would be put at risk as a result. But the lack of notification would have to be justified in writing.
The policy also would cover conversations between a student and a counselor — even if the student has not acted on feelings related to gender identify. Speakers against the resolution included Stephanie Camacho-Van Dyke, director of advocacy and education for the LGBTQ Center OC in Orange County.
